Tough Loss for the Halos​

Our Los Angeles Angels faced off against the Oakland Athletics, and despite a valiant effort, we fell short with a final score of 5-7. Let’s break down the game. ⚾

Slow Start for Both Teams​

The first three innings were pretty uneventful, with both teams struggling to get anything going offensively. Our boys, Nolan Schanuel, Luis Rengifo, and Taylor Ward, all had at-bats but couldn't find a way to get on base. The Athletics were equally held in check by our pitching.

Athletics Take the Lead​

The bottom of the 4th inning saw the Athletics break the deadlock. Brent Rooker hit a solo homer to center, followed by a three-run homer by Lawrence Butler. We suddenly found ourselves trailing 4-0. 😔

Angels Fight Back​

In the top of the 5th, we put up our first run. Brandon Drury started off with a single, advanced to third on a single from Jo Adell, and finally scored on a sacrifice fly by Nolan Schanuel. A glimmer of hope! 🌟 We were now down 4-1.

More Damage in the 6th​

The Athletics struck again in the bottom of the 6th, extending their lead to 7-1. Brett Harris doubled to drive in two more runs, and JJ Bleday capped it off with another RBI single. It's always tough watching the deficit grow. 😓

A Spark in the 7th​

Our Angels didn’t give up! In the top of the 7th, Schanuel delivered once more with a single that brought in two runs. We had cut the lead to 7-3. 🧡

Final Push in the 9th​

In the top of the 9th, we mounted a last-ditch comeback attempt. Drury walked and Schanuel doubled to score him, bringing us to 7-4. Rengifo followed with a single to bring in Schanuel. It was now 7-5 with the tying run at the plate! However, Ward struck out swinging to end the game. Just heartbreak. 💔

Looking Ahead​

Despite the loss, there were some bright spots. Nolan Schanuel and Luis Rengifo showed their mettle, producing key hits and driving in runs. Our bullpen will need to tighten things up, but there's potential to bounce back in the next game. Let's keep our heads up and support the squad! 💪👼
